Where Ancient Temples Embrace Modern Skyscrapers: The Soul of Bang Rak

Nestled along the majestic Chao Phraya River, Bang Rak is a vibrant tapestry of culture, history, and modernity in Bangkok. Known for its enchanting temples and stunning skyscrapers, including the iconic Bangkok Mahanakhon, this neighborhood invites you to explore bustling markets, gourmet eateries, and charming street vendors. Stroll through the serene riverside parks or indulge in a luxury dining experience with panoramic views. Whether you're savoring local delicacies or immersing yourself in the rich heritage of the area, Bang Rak offers a dynamic blend of experiences that captivate every traveler’s heart.

Things to do near Bang Rak

Bang Rak is a vibrant blend of bustling markets and serene riverside views, offering travelers a chance to explore dynamic shopping scenes alongside peaceful waterfront strolls. Enjoy leisurely boat rides, soak in the skyline from high-rise vantage points, or unwind at lush parks, making it a delightful urban escape.

  • Khaosan RoadOpens in a new window – Dive into the vibrant heart of Bangkok at Khaosan Road, a bustling street known for its lively atmosphere. Explore an eclectic mix of shops, street food stalls, and bars that come alive with music as the sun sets. Whether you’re looking to mingle with fellow travelers, sample delicious Thai cuisine, or shop for unique souvenirs, Khaosan Road offers an unforgettable experience. Don’t forget to take a stroll along the river nearby, where you can enjoy the stunning views of the city’s skyline and indulge in a little people-watching.
  • Erawan ShrineOpens in a new window – Discover the spiritual side of Bangkok at the Erawan Shrine, a revered site that attracts both locals and tourists. Marvel at the intricate architecture and the beautiful sculptures that adorn this serene shrine. Join the devotees in offering prayers or simply soak in the tranquil atmosphere. The shrine is nestled in the midst of skyscrapers, making it a fascinating contrast of spirituality amidst the bustling city. It’s an ideal spot to reflect and appreciate the cultural richness of Thailand.
